About Converting Nanograms per Cup to Grams per Gallon
Nanogram per Cup and Gram per Gallon both measure density — mass per unit volume — a property used to identify materials, check manufacturing quality, and predict whether something floats or sinks. As a fixed reference point, water has a density of exactly 1000 kg/m³ (1 g/cm³, 1 g/mL) at its temperature of maximum density, which is why many density figures in science and engineering are quoted relative to water. Both are mass per volume density units.
Formula
grams per gallon = nanograms per cup × 1.6e-8
This factor comes from each unit's defined relationship to the category's base unit: 1 nanogram per cup equals 4.226753e-9 base units, and 1 gram per gallon equals 0.264172052358 base units, so dividing one by the other gives the direct nanogram per cup-to-gram per gallon factor of 1.6e-8.

What's the difference between density and mass concentration?
Density is the mass of a pure substance or material per unit volume. Mass concentration is the mass of one component — like a dissolved solute — within a mixture's total volume. The two use the same kind of units but describe different physical situations.
